Really interesting. How does openpilot interface with the car? Is it a truly hands off experience?

 

Also your videos made it look like the braking is sometimes very hard and sharp. What kind of mpg does openpilot return? Which corolla do u have?

I just made a new video and the first half covered some of these questions.

I would say it is mostly hand-free and foot-free on highways already. I probably only need to intervene once or twice in a one-hour trip.

On braking - I'm not sure if you were referring to when it's on city roads, as on highways I actually find it brakes more smoothly than I do!
And btw you can tell if it was me or openpilot driving from the color of the surrounding box - it's blue if it's me, and it turns green when openpilot is engaged.

MPG does seem like a price you'll pay by using openpilot. I noticed even constant-speed cruising will use both the engine and Battery while on openpilot. I'll probably do another video on this in the future. From my experience it's about 45-50 mpg on highways.

My car is a Corolla Touring Sports Hybrid 1.8. Let me know if you have other questions.
